    Some features of the phonetic and grammatical structure of Baca
    (1953) Jordan, A C
    As the title implies, at this stage I am not embarking on a complete text-book of Baca, but am attempting to make an exposition of those phonetic and grammatical features of Baca that are not shared with standard Zulu and standard Xhosa. Stress has therefore been laid on the differentiae of Baca. My investigation reveals that the most remarkable differences are practically phonological and morphological, and that syntactical differences are practically negligible in quantity. For this reason, no section of this dissertation is devoted to syntax as such.
